I picked up a leaflet for Cragside and kept it as I thought it looked interesting. Then Calv started talking about an ‘electricity’ house. We eventually determined it was one and the same place (as Cragside was the first house in the world to be powered by hydro-electricity).
Cragside is situated near the village of Rothbury. It’s a huge estate comprising 1000 acres, 5 lakes (created by William Armstrong to help create the hydro-electricity to power the house). There are 14 waymarked walks (both long, short and interchangeable), a boathouse, ‘trim trail’ and a circular drive around the whole estate (with several car parks to stop off in and pick up 1 of the trails).
